Jack Rowan is an accomplished English actor who has made a name for himself in the entertainment industry with his impressive performances on both the big and small screens. With a career that is steadily on the rise, Rowan has proven himself to be a versatile and compelling actor, capable of tackling a wide range of roles with ease and authenticity.

Rowan first gained attention for his role as a troubled teenager in the hit British crime drama series "Born to Kill." His portrayal of Sam, a young man struggling with his dark and violent impulses, earned him critical acclaim and showcased his ability to bring depth and complexity to his characters. Rowan's performance in "Born to Kill" was a testament to his talent as an actor, and it firmly established him as a rising star in the industry.

Following the success of "Born to Kill," Rowan continued to build on his momentum with standout performances in a variety of projects. In the BBC One drama "Noughts + Crosses," he played the role of Callum McGregor, a young man who navigates the treacherous landscape of a dystopian society divided by race and class. Rowan's portrayal of Callum was both heartbreaking and powerful, drawing audiences in with his emotional depth and conviction.

Who does Jack Rowan play in Peaky Blinders?

Jack Rowan is a British actor best known for his role as Bonnie Gold on 'Peaky Blinders' and currently stars in the BBC drama 'Noughts + Crosses'. 'Noughts + Crosses' premiered on Thursday 5th March 2020 on BBC1, you can catch up and stream the entire series on BBC iPlayer now by clicking here.


Is Jack Rowan a boxer?

Before becoming an actor, Rowan was an amateur boxer from age 12, winning 18 of 27 fights.

Who played the boxer in Peaky Blinders?

In season four of "Peaky Blinders," viewers were introduced to scrappy newcomer fighter Bonnie Gold. Played by Jack Rowan, Bonnie was brought into the story as a bargaining chip between Thomas "Tommy" Shelby (Cillian Murphy) and Bonnie's father Aberama Gold (Aidan Gillen).Oct 1, 2022
